Output 010258d9ab7f33462faad2d37bf8f7aa4ba639e7ae00169f6cfe1de62be511f5:11

value
597428
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52aed17df61d479ba5a6db95a701d228b1d0a4ba OP_EQUAL
address
39ECks5ZKJTWn47bQSBQKptoL4NrmTtcWH
transaction
010258d9ab7f33462faad2d37bf8f7aa4ba639e7ae00169f6cfe1de62be511f5